I may be wrong on this because I have not heard nor research it at
Cisco. From what I know, it is not possible to totally lock a router
down without password recovery (ctrl-break)unless you implement physical
security. However, remember that no can password recover over the
Internet but need direct access to the router.  Why would you want to
stop it because if you do and you forget your password or whatever, it
may be more frustrating and costly than implementing physical security.
